BIG STRIKE IN CHICAGO.
40,000 WORKMEN IDLE. (Received 12.50 p.m.) CHICAGO, June 8. Forty thousand men have been thrown out of employment by a bricklayers' strike, and contracts totalling ten millions sterling are help up. A settlement of the strike is probable to-day on the basis of a compromise granting some increase in the scale of wages.
